Tropicanna Cherries
Breeder: Relentless Genetics
Tropicanna Cookies x Cherry Cookies F3
Sativa Dominant
8-9 weeks
Difficulty: Intermediate
Yield: moderate-heavy
Grow type: indoor, light dep, outdoor
Kaprikorn's Description
Tropicanna Cherries is moderate-heavy yielding Sativa dominant strain that smells like fresh fruits and sweet cheese. She forms a 4-5 nodal top cola with a tightly disconnected cola structure beneath giving it the appearance of braiding. Her buds are dense with a high trichome production, a low leaf-to-calyx ratio, and have minimal restacked calyxes giving the buds a bulbous shape. Her buds are half dollar in size and are a unique bright pinkish-magenta color that is sure to turn heads. She is a moderately uptaking plant that has some sensitivity to overwatering and over-fertilization, therefore we recommend growing with care. She will double in size in flower and is a very sturdy plant that is easily pruned and defoliated. Overall Tropicanna Cherries is an intermediate strain to grow due to her uptaking sensitivities but will do well in any style of grow.
Smoking Profile
Tropicanna Cherries is ideal for daytime use when users want to stay engaged and inspired, evoking productive, focused and cozy qualities. She has gorgeous buds, with stunning shades of strawberry, orange cream, magenta, and dark purple accented by vibrant orange hairs. This strain's aroma is very strong of sweet fruit reminiscent of strawberries and bubblegum. The flavor is fruity with a creamy smoke that enhances the delightful taste, making each puff enjoyable and smooth, true treat for the eyes and the palate!
